In-situ crystallization studies of gels in the ZrO2---SiO2 system

The in-situ investigation of amorphous gels is important in understanding the evolution of structures and the influence of environmental factors on crystallization. In this paper, the ZrO2---SiO2 system has been studied in-situ under electron beam heating. The study reveals that both the size of the ZrO2 particles and the presence of hydroxyl ions influence the nature of the crystalline phase of the ZrO2 particles formed.
